Definition and Meaning of the US 12153 Model Answers 2012 Form

The US 12153 model answers 2012 form is a specific document used by taxpayers to request a Collection Due Process (CDP) hearing with the IRS Office of Appeals. This form is crucial for taxpayers who have received lien or levy notices and wish to appeal those actions. The form outlines the taxpayer's information, identifies the type of notice involved, and provides a basis for the hearing request. It facilitates the taxpayer's right to challenge the IRS's decisions, ensuring that they can present their case and potentially resolve disputes regarding their tax issues.

The completion of the US 12153 form is an essential step for individuals wanting to ensure that their rights are preserved during the IRS collection process. By filing this form, taxpayers can initiate a formal dialogue with the IRS regarding the collection actions taken against them, allowing for the possibility of negotiations or alternative arrangements.

Steps to Complete the US 12153 Model Answers 2012 Form

Completing the US 12153 model answers 2012 form requires careful attention and accurate information. The following steps provide a structured approach to ensure clarity and compliance:

  1. Gather Required Information: Collect necessary personal details, including name, address, Social Security number, and tax identification number.
  2. Identify the Notice: Clearly state the type of IRS notice you received, such as a Notice of Federal Tax Lien or a Levy Notice. This helps establish the context for your request.
  3. Provide a Basis for Your Hearing Request: Articulate the reasons for disputing the IRS's actions. This may include circumstances like financial hardship, improper notification, or other relevant details that support your case.
  4. Complete the Form: Fill out all sections of the form accurately. Ensure that each required field is addressed to avoid processing delays.
  5. Review and Sign: Carefully review the completed form for accuracy. Sign and date the form to validate your request.
  6. Submit the Form: Send the form to the appropriate address listed in the instructions. Note whether electronic submission is allowed or if physical mailing is required.

Important Considerations

  • Maintain copies of all communications and the submitted form for your records.
  • Be aware of filing deadlines associated with your notice to ensure timely submission of your hearing request.

Key Elements of the US 12153 Model Answers 2012 Form

Understanding the essential components of the US 12153 model answers 2012 form is vital for successful completion. Here are the significant elements:

  • Taxpayer Identification: The form requires the taxpayer's full name, address, Social Security number, and any other identifying information that the IRS needs for processing.
  • Type of Notice: Clearly indicate the specific IRS notice being disputed. Accurate classification of the notice affects the context of the hearing request.
  • Basis for Request: This section demands a detailed explanation of why the taxpayer believes the IRS's actions are erroneous or unjust. This explanation is critical to persuade the IRS to grant a hearing.
  • Signatory Requirements: A signature is mandatory to authenticate the request, confirming that the information provided is accurate and true to the best of the taxpayer's knowledge.

Filing Deadlines and Important Dates for the US 12153 Model Answers 2012 Form

Understanding critical filing deadlines is essential for maximizing the efficacy of your hearing request using the US 12153 model answers 2012 form. Key dates include:

  • Notice Issuance Date: This is the date on which the IRS notice is sent and marks the beginning of the timeframe for filing a response. Taxpayers typically have thirty days from this date to submit the form.
  • Deadline Reminders: The IRS may provide deadlines on the notice itself, including the last day to request a hearing. Mark these dates clearly to ensure timely submissions.

Consequences of Missed Deadlines

Failing to submit the US 12153 model answers 2012 form within the specified timeframe may result in the loss of the opportunity to contest the lien or levy action, emphasizing the importance of acting quickly and efficiently to protect taxpayer rights.
